Athlete profiles along grit, sport orientation and sport persistence based on a quantitative research on Hungarian athletes
IntroductionSport persistence, the sustained engagement in sporting activities, is influenced by a combination of intrinsic and extrinsic motivational factors. Understanding these factors is crucial for supporting long-term athlete commitment and preventing dropout. The study examines athlete profil...
